The Boston Bruins kicked off the 2025 NHL season with a thrilling 3-1 victory over the Washington Capitals at the Capital One Arena in Washington, D.C. Right winger David Pastrnak scored the game’s first goal and set up Elias Lindholm’s game-winner, while goaltender Jeremy Swayman made 35 saves to secure the win.
Pastrnak Picks Up Where He Left Off
Pastrnak, the Bruins’ star right winger, wasted no time making an impact in the new season. He scored the game’s first goal in the second period, giving the Bruins an early lead. Later, he set up Lindholm’s game-winning goal 38 seconds after the Capitals had tied the game in the third period.
